﻿.plat{margin:40px auto 50px auto;overflow:hidden}
.plat h1{font-size:30px;color:#323232;text-align:center;height:70px;font-weight:normal}
.plat h1 em{color:#e63734}
.plat p{font-size:17px;color:#999;line-height:1.9em;text-align:center;width:90%;margin:0 auto;margin-bottom:50px}
.plat .img{height:170px;background:url(/images/un_plat.jpg) center 0 no-repeat;}
.plat .txt{width:1200px;margin:20px auto 30px auto;height:200px}
.plat .txt em{display:block;text-align:center;font-size:18px;}
.plat i{display:block;background:url(/images/un_plat2.png) 0px -14px no-repeat;width:140px;margin:0 auto 20px auto;height:145px}
.plat .txt div{float:left;width:20%;text-align:center;cursor:pointer}
.plat .i2{background-position-x:-263px}
.plat .i3{background-position-x:-533px}
.plat .i4{background-position-x:-803px}
.plat .i5{background-position-x:-1071px}

.fun{height:650px;background:url(/images/un_fun_bg.jpg) 0 center no-repeat #3a3f46;padding-top:35px;overflow:hidden}
.fun h1{font-size:28px;color:#fff;text-align:center;height:60px;font-weight:normal}
.fun h1 em{color:#e63734}
.fun .i{border-bottom:1px dashed #fff;padding:40px 0 30px 0;height:auto;overflow:hidden}
.fun .i p{float:left;width:96px;color:#fff;margin-right:42px;cursor:pointer}
.fun .i i{display:block;background:url(/images/un_fun.png) 13px 0 no-repeat;height:60px;width:100%;margin-bottom:15px}
.fun .i em{font-size:24px;display:block;width:100%;text-align:center;}
.fun .i .p9{margin-right:0px}
.fun .i .tg{background-position-y:-76px}
.fun .i .kd{background-position-y:-520px}
.fun .i .sc{background-position-y:-450px}
.fun .i .wm{background-position-y:-153px}
.fun .i .wzk{background-position-y:-600px}
.fun .i .ms{background-position-y:-220px}
.fun .i .jf{background-position-y:-298px}
.fun .i .vr{background-position-y:-670px}
.fun .i .zx{background-position-y:-745px}
.fun .i .xx{background-position-y:-822px}
.fun .i .y114{background-position-y:-896px}
.fun .i .mq{background-position-y:-1269px}
.fun .i .zp{background-position-y:-970px}
.fun .i .fc{background-position-y:-1117px}
.fun .i .lt{background-position-y:-1042px}
.fun .i .wz{background-position-y:-1192px}
.fun .i .fx{background-position-y:-1342px}
.fun .i .pc{background-position-y:-1790px}
.fun .i .tp{background-position-y:-1492px}
.fun .i .hbq{background-position-y:-1419px}
.fun .i .cj{background-position-y:-1642px}
.fun .i .zl{background-position-y:-1718px}
.fun .i .kj{background-position-y:-1566px}
.fun .i .yhq{background-position-y:-1566px}
.fun .i .gd{background-position-y:-1940px}

.t {text-align:center;margin:10px 0 30px 0}
.t h1 { color: #333; font-size: 30px; font-weight:normal;height:50px}
.t p { font-size: 16px; color: #999; }

.stre{overflow:hidden;padding:20px 0 40px 0}
.stre i{display:block;background:url(/images/un_stre.jpg) 0 0 no-repeat;width:200px;margin:0 auto 20px auto;height:230px}
.stre .txt{width:1200px;margin:0 auto 30px auto;}
.stre .txt div{width:230px;margin-right:10px; text-align:center;font-size:18px;float:left;position:relative;cursor:pointer}
.stre .txt em{display:block;font-size:24px;color:#333;height:40px}
.stre .txt p{color:#999;line-height:1.8em;font-size:14px}
.stre .i2{background-position-x:-250px}
.stre .i3{background-position-x:-500px}
.stre .i4{background-position-x:-750px}
.stre .i5{background-position-x:-1000px}

.case{background:#eff4f7;overflow:hidden;padding:20px 0 40px 0}
.case .cs { height: auto;overflow:hidden }
.case .logo { text-align: center;padding-top:10px }
.case .logo img { width: 200px; }
.case .c { background: #fff; width: 286px;float:left;margin:0 13px 13px 0;position:relative;border-radius:10px;border:2px solid #cfe8fb }
.case .c a { display: block;width:100%;height:100% }
.case .c4 { margin: 0px; }
.case .p { font-size: 12px; color: #999; line-height: 1.8em; padding: 10px; height:80px}
.case .float-bg,.case .float,.case .fl { position: absolute; top: 0px; left: 0px; width: 100%; height: 100%; z-index:2;display:none;border-radius:10px}
.case .float-bg {background:#000;opacity:0.7;-moz-opacity:0.7; filter:alpha(opacity=70);z-index:1}
.case .float div { float: left; width:50%;text-align:center;padding-top:20px;color:#fff;height:145px}
.case .float div img { width: 100px; border: 6px solid #fff; }
.case .float .wx {width:112px;border:0px }
.case .img3 div { width: 33.3%; padding-top:30px;height:130px}
.case .img3 div img { width: 76px; }
.case .img3 .wx { width: 88px; }
.case .link { text-align:center;width:100%!important;font-size:12px;padding:0px!important}
.case .more { height: 177px;margin-right:0px; padding-top:15px}
.case .more div { background: url(/images/k_1.png) no-repeat;padding:2px;width:167px;height:167px;margin-left:62px }
.case .more div img { width: 163px; height:  163px; }


.news { padding: 50px 0 80px 0; overflow:hidden}
.news .n { width: 570px;float:left;margin-right:20px; }
.news  h3 { font-weight: 600; font-size: 18px; color:#333;position:relative;height:50px}
.news  h3 em{border-bottom:2px solid #57b5fe;padding-bottom:8px}
.news .n h3 a { position: absolute; right: 0px; top:1px; font-size: 14px; font-weight: normal; color:#666}
.news .n .img { height: 80px;margin-bottom:17px;padding:8px 0;border:1px solid #eaeaea }
.news .n .img img { width: 100%;}
.news .n li { height: 34px; line-height: 34px; }
.news .n li a { color: #333; }
.news .n li span { color: #999; padding-right: 5px; }
.news .n2{margin:0px;border-left:1px solid #ececec;padding-left:29px}

.de { text-align:center;padding:20px 0}
.de .h { font-size: 28px; text-align: center; height: 60px; font-weight: normal }
.de .r1{width:910px;margin:15px auto;height:330px}
.de .d{width:250px;margin:0 80px 20px 0;float:left}
.de .d:last-child{margin:0}
.de .r2{text-align:center}
.de .qr { width: 100%; margin: 0 auto 20px auto; border: 2px dashed #05cd8c; padding: 10px; box-sizing: border-box; border-radius: 5px }
.de .qr img { width: 100% }
.de .d:last-child { margin: 0 }
.de p { font-size: 15px; }
.de .url{font-size:25px;height:40px}